What We Do

Commonwealth Positivity’s philanthropic mission is focused on three key areas of engagement, each designed to increase awareness, encourage collaboration, and empower small charities operating within economically developing Commonwealth countries. All of our work in these areas is supported and delivered through our bespoke digital platform—the Commonwealth Portal.

First, we organise educational and informative webinars that highlight individual Commonwealth countries and the British, Australian, Canadian and New Zealand charities working on the ground within them. By leveraging our extensive social media presence across the United Kingdom and other Commonwealth nations, alongside the accessibility of Zoom Webinars, we connect audiences to stories and insights that foster greater cultural understanding. These events are coordinated and hosted via the Commonwealth Portal, where users can view upcoming sessions, register for participation, and access past recordings and resources.

Through these virtual events, we aim to increase awareness, identify areas for collaboration, and celebrate the impactful work of small international development charities. The goal is always to inspire support—whether through volunteerism, partnerships, or donations—that enables these organisations to thrive. All related educational content and follow-up materials are made available through the Commonwealth Portal.

Secondly, Commonwealth Positivity hosts a series of in-person events, with initial programmes launching in the United Kingdom, Australia, Canada, and New Zealand. These events are designed to blend education, networking, and cultural engagement. Each event spotlights a specific Commonwealth country, promotes cultural awareness, and provides a platform for small development charities to share their work. Whether a roundtable discussion, seminar, or networking reception, these gatherings also create valuable opportunities for young leaders to grow their professional networks and explore pathways into international development. Event registration, details, and updates are managed exclusively through the Commonwealth Portal.

We work closely with institutions of higher learning, our Commonwealth Commissioner Programme, and diplomatic missions accredited to the Commonwealth countries to ensure our in-person events are inclusive, impactful, and aligned with our charitable objectives. In every case, the aim is to deepen understanding and elevate the visibility of the charities whose work reflects the shared values of the Commonwealth.

Finally, our cornerstone initiative is the Commonwealth Portal itself—a free, pro-bono digital hub designed specifically to support small international development charities with a focus on Commonwealth nations. With around 5,000 such charities operating on limited budgets (under £1 million in annual turnover) in the United Kingdom alone, this platform enables them to access vital resources, reduce costs, and form meaningful connections with peers, policy leaders, and supporters. The Portal is central to our mission, offering a space where charities can grow, collaborate, and amplify their impact.

Through each of these pillars—webinars, in-person events, and the digital portal—Commonwealth Positivity continues to champion the extraordinary work of small charities, support cultural awareness, and bring Commonwealth citizens closer together in shared purpose and mutual respect
